#if (__CORE__ == __ARM6M__) /* Cortex-M0/M0+/M1 (v6-M, v6S-M)? */
#define QXK_ARM_ERRATUM_838869() ((void)0)
#else /* Cortex-M3/M4/M7 (v7-M) */
/* The following macro implements the recommended workaround for the
* ARM Erratum 838869. Specifically, for Cortex-M3/M4/M7 the DSB
* (memory barrier) instruction needs to be added before exiting an ISR.
*/
#define QXK_ARM_ERRATUM_838869() __DSB()
#endif
